dotNetRDF is a .Net Class Library for working with RDF and SPARQL programatically built with C# 3 for the .Net Framework 3.5/4.0/Silverlight 4 and WIndows Phone 7. It provides a simple object model for representing RDF, SPARQL Queries and Updates and understands all common RDF and SPARQL syntaxes.
Extensive documentation is available on the website and support is available via the mailing lists.
